Introduction
In "Dungeons of Dune (Act 2)," Gom Jabbar: A Dune Podcast continues its immersive exploration of the Dune universe through a Dungeons & Dragons (D&D) campaign. Hosted by Abu and Leo, with Noah serving as the Dungeon Master (DM), this episode delves deeper into the perilous adventures unfolding on the desert planet of Arrakis.
Setting the Scene
The episode picks up with the characters amidst a raging Coriolis storm on Arrakis. Their shuttle has crashed, leaving them stranded within the wreckage. The intense storm outside sets a tense and urgent tone for the unfolding drama.
Key Characters
- Razak (Leo): A seasoned smuggler navigating the harsh desert environment.
- Dr. Ziggy Circa (Abu): A Souk Doctor tasked with protecting Lord Benedict Borgin, a young heir embroiled in political intrigue.
- Noah: The Dungeon Master guiding the narrative and orchestrating challenges.
Survival Amidst Chaos
The characters grapple with immediate survival challenges:
- Storm Shelter: Bunkered inside a wing of the downed shuttle, they assess their situation and strategize their next moves.
- Resource Management: Abu expresses anxiety over the young lord's safety and the scarcity of resources, while Leo contemplates the balance between protecting the lord and pursuing lucrative smuggling opportunities.

Encounter with Deception and Danger
As the storm subsides, the characters emerge to confront new threats:
- Discovery of Fallen Allies: They find deceased members of their group, including a House Borjéan guard and smuggling allies named Red.
- Poisoning Incident: A critical moment unfolds when Lord Benedict inadvertently consumes poisoned juice boxes, incapacitating him and adding urgency to their predicament.

Strategic Decisions and Exploration
Facing dwindling resources and potential traps:
- Weapon Acquisition: Despite finding a crysknife—a sacred Fremen weapon—Leo decides against arming Abu, prioritizing diplomacy over confrontation.
- Navigational Challenges: The group meticulously maneuvers through treacherous dunes, avoiding sandworms and ensuring their path towards the shattered shield wall of Arrakeen.

Unveiling Hidden Dangers
Within the cave system:
- Trap Identification: Razak detects a concealed trap on the stairs, allowing the group to navigate safely and avoid potential pitfalls.
- Suspensor Devices: Leo ingeniously repurposes hexagonal suspensor pads from their fallen allies to maneuver through the narrow passages, showcasing his resourcefulness.
